0
0
24
210
720
1716
3360
5814
9240
13800
19656

what's the next number
 
Physics news on Phys.org
  • #2
He-he. It's 26970
 
  • #3
a = (3n - 1) * (3n) * (3n + 1), starting with n = 0

What is "Another number pattern"?

"Another number pattern" refers to a sequence of numbers that follows a specific rule or pattern. This can be seen as a mathematical puzzle or challenge to determine the next number in the sequence.

Why do patterns in numbers matter?

Patterns in numbers are important because they can help us understand and predict natural phenomena, and they also play a crucial role in many fields of science and mathematics, such as cryptography, computer science, and physics.

How do you identify and solve number patterns?

To identify and solve number patterns, you need to carefully observe the sequence of numbers and look for any repeating patterns or relationships between the numbers. Once you have identified the pattern, you can use it to predict the next number in the sequence.

What are some common types of number patterns?

Some common types of number patterns include arithmetic sequences, geometric sequences, and Fibonacci sequences. Other types include triangular numbers, square numbers, and prime numbers.
